Delphi 7 Enterprise или Delphi 2010 Professional

На работе я использовал Delphi 6 & 7 Enterprise в течение нескольких лет. Несколько лет назад я купил личную копию Turbo Delphi Professional. Из-за этого я имею право на обновление Delphi 2010 Professional. Но я не имею права на обновление Delphi 2010 Enterprise.

Стоит ли покупать Delphi 2010 Professional Upgrade или я должен искать Delphi 7 Enterprise?

Моя попытка купить Delphi включает в себя написание многоуровневых приложений баз данных для целей обучения.

Любой совет будет оценен.

ТИА!

4 ответа

Решение

Delphi 2010 намного опережает Delphi 7, особенно DataSnap.

На вашем месте я бы напрямую связался с Embarcadero и посмотрел, что потребуется для обновления до Delphi 2010 Enterprise. Я бы также последовал совету Боба и получил SA.

http://embarcadero.com/products/rad-studio/rad-studio-feature-matrix.pdf

Обновление Delphi 2010 Professional стоит всего 399 евро, и прямо сейчас (до понедельника, 28 июня) вы получите RAD Studio 2010 Professional (а также бесплатную загрузку Delphi Prism 2011). Обратите внимание, что Professional Edition не включает DataSnap 2010 для многоуровневой разработки баз данных. Для этого вам понадобится Delphi 2010 Enterprise - лицензия на нового пользователя обойдется в 1999 евро и даст вам RAD Studio 2010 Enterprise...

Delphi 7 Enterprise доступна только как лицензии для новых пользователей и стоит 2490 евро. Более дорогой, чем выпуск Delphi 2010 Enterprise New User...

Лично я бы пошел на Delphi 2010 - и обязательно включил бы подписку (на уровне RAD Studio), чтобы вы наверняка знали, что получите Delphi 2011 и RAD Studio 2011, когда они станут доступны...

Groetjes, Боб Сварт (www.bobswart.nl или www.bobswart.com)

PS: все цены указаны без НДС;-)

Delphi 2010 Professional включает в себя DataSnap TDataSetProvider и TClientDataSet, но позволяет использовать их только в двухуровневых приложениях.

Тем не менее, если вы захотите перейти на уровень предприятия позднее, было бы относительно просто создать эти 2-уровневые приложения DataSnap, 3-уровневые приложения DataSnap.

Есть также несколько других способов написания 3-уровневых приложений с использованием Delphi 2010 Professional, которые не включают DataSnap или не требуют уровня Enterprise. Сторонние библиотеки, такие как RemObjects, kbmMW, RealThinClient, предоставляют альтернативные многоуровневые решения для DataSnap.

Я согласен с Лаухланом. Я пошел с 2010 Pro именно по этим причинам. Я думаю, что для личных проектов вы получите 90% выгоды, написав два уровня демонстрационных приложений DataSnap, а затем построите свои три уровня с использованием других библиотек. Я также использую Pro на работе, потому что дополнительные затраты на обновление огромны, и для нас нет никакой реальной выгоды. Это не похоже на Delphi 3, где доступ к базе данных был ограничен, если вы не заплатили дополнительно.

Я также очень внимательно посмотрел бы на специальные предложения. Если вы изучаете базы данных, возможно, стоит посмотреть, можете ли вы заключить сделку "купи один, получи один бесплатно" (BOGOF) и использовать ее, чтобы получить один из инструментов базы данных Embarcadero. Мне кажется, что каждые пару месяцев появляется новое специальное предложение, поэтому задержка обновления может окупиться, и вы можете позволить себе подождать.

Другие вопросы по тегам